How can businesses effectively communicate the benefits of emotional intelligence training to their customer service representatives in order to ensure successful implementation and improved customer satisfaction?
Businesses can effectively communicate the benefits of emotional intelligence training to their customer service representatives by highlighting how it can enhance their ability to understand and empathize with customers, leading to improved communication and problem-solving skills. Providing real-life examples or case studies demonstrating the positive impact of emotional intelligence on customer interactions can also help to illustrate the value of the training. Additionally, offering incentives or rewards for employees who successfully implement emotional intelligence strategies in their interactions with customers can further motivate them to engage in the training and apply it in their role. Regular feedback and support from managers or trainers can help reinforce the importance of emotional intelligence and encourage its consistent practice in customer service interactions.
